Abstract
The present status of experimental and theoretical work on continuous wave laser-assisted reaction of metals with oxygen is presented. Differences between this and normal isothermal oxidation of metals are emphasized. Available theoretical models are discussed. They deal with roles of thermal history, feedback effects between optical absorption and reaction rate. The nature of so-called “non-purely thermal” effects is discussed. Hints for further research are presented.
